![]() 44
2. Menentukan perubahan state
Perubahan
state
direpresentasikan
dengan anak panah yang menghubungkan
dua state yang saling berkaitan sesuai dengan kriteria atau urutan
kejadiannya. Notasinya adalah sebagai berikut :
State 1
State 2
State 3
Gambar 2.17 Notasi perubahan state pada STD
3. Menentukan conditions dan actions
Conditions adalah
hal
yang
mengakibatkan perubahan state. Conditions dapat
juga diartikan sebagai event yang berada di luar lingkungan sistem
yang dapat
dideteksi
oleh
sistem.
Conditions dapat
berupa
input,
sinyal,
gangguan,
dan
lain
lain.
Sedangkan
actions
adalah
apa
yang
sistem lakukan
apabila state
berubah.
Actions
dapat
berupa
output,
tampilan
pesan,
dan
lain
lain.
Notasinya adalah sebagai berikut.
Gambar 2.18 Notasi condition dan action pada STD
|